Cordatis successfully defends the IRS’s award of a BPA award to Allicent Technology, LLC

A Cordatis team consisting of Daniel Strouse and John O’Brien successfully defended the award of an IRS BPA to Allicent Technology, LLC. In defending the award, Cordatis rebutted the protestor’s arguments about the IRS’s evaluation and best-value tradeoff.
